Job Summary
The Radiology Specialist is responsible for performing diagnostic imaging procedures, ensuring high-quality images for accurate diagnosis, maintaining patient safety, and supporting physicians in the evaluation and treatment of patients. The role requires adherence to radiation safety standards, professional ethics, and healthcare regulations.
Key Responsibilities
- Perform diagnostic imaging examinations including X-ray, CT, MRI, Mammography, Fluoroscopy, and other imaging procedures as assigned.
- Prepare patients for imaging procedures by explaining the process and addressing concerns.
- Operate and maintain radiology equipment according to manufacturer and healthcare facility guidelines.
- Ensure high-quality diagnostic images while minimizing patient exposure to radiation.
- Monitor patients during imaging procedures and respond appropriately to emergencies.
- Follow radiation protection and infection control protocols.
- Review images for quality and completeness before submission to radiologists.
- Maintain accurate patient records and documentation within the hospital information system.
- Collaborate with radiologists, phys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to ensure effective patient care.
- Report equipment malfunctions and coordinate maintenance when required.
- Stay updated on advances in radiology technology and best practices.
